Output e8b07d4430dbfc6bec1622a47e660a50a1cabe86bed19bc879ae224fcfd005cd:0

value
577119
script pubkey
OP_0 OP_PUSHBYTES_20 3aa0f2c43871bc1a4cbe93b67d9600e4516779e6
address
bc1q82s093pcwx7p5n97jwm8m9squ3gkw70xhlc9pj
transaction
e8b07d4430dbfc6bec1622a47e660a50a1cabe86bed19bc879ae224fcfd005cd
confirmations
193713
spent
true